In order to grow, bones need proper nutrition, including adequate amounts of calcium, vitamin D, protein, and other essential nutrients. Regular weight-bearing exercise is also important for bone growth and strength. Adequate rest and maintaining a healthy lifestyle contribute to overall bone health and growth.

Cells need phosphorus for various essential functions, such as forming the backbone of DNA and RNA, facilitating energy transfer through ATP, and regulating metabolic pathways. Phosphorus is also crucial for cell membrane structure and function.
